How Minolast FX 10mg/120mg Tablet works:
Montelukast, a leukotriene receptor inhibitor, counteracts the effects of leukotrienes, inflammatory mediators. This action diminishes airway and nasal inflammation, thereby alleviating symptoms. Fexofenadine, an antihistamine, similarly inhibits histamine, another inflammatory messenger, responsible for nasal discharge, lacrimation, and sneezing.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Use of alcohol with Minolast FX 10mg/120mg Tablets requires careful consideration. Seek medical advice before combining them.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Minolast FX 10mg/120m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ible risks prior to prescribing this medication. Seek medical advice before use.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Breastfeeding mothers can likely use Minolast FX 10mg/120mg Tablets safely. Available human data indicates minimal ris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Minolast FX 10mg/120mg Tablets may c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ness, potentially impairing alertness. Refrain from driving if you experience these side eff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should use Minolast FX 10mg/120mg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Physician consultation is advised. In those with advanced kidney disease, excessive drowsiness may occur.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Minolast FX 10mg/120mg tablets in patients with liver impairment is likely safe. Current evidence indicates dose modification may not be necessary, but physician consultation is recommended.
